Learn more: Job Summary Responsible for the evaluation of patients, determining plan-of-care and goals of treatment, participating in treatment of patients within the scope of Physical Therapy. May provide oversight to therapy assistants and/or students in following the plan-of-care and treatment of patients appropriate to the age of the patient served; may provide supervision to therapy aides and/or volunteers. Works as part of a patient care team toward the best outcomes for the patient. What you will do: + Evaluates assigned patients and establishes a treatment plan and goals, using data from a variety of sources, such as patient records, interviews, observation, and team members. + Provides patient treatment according to plan of care and modifies plan to meet patient needs, and updates plan as appropriate. + Completes documentation accurately, timely, according to regulatory and state licensure requirements, and within professional standards. + Collaborates with other healthcare professionals as necessary to ensure smooth continuous care of the patients. May act as a liaison with nursing, medical and other therapy staffs to facilitate problem solving and coordination of other services and act as an educational resource. + May mentor and provide oversight to new caregivers, physical therapist assistants, and/or therapy aides. Provides clinical instruction and training to students. + Recommends and participates in development of new services and programs, quality improvement and monitoring activities. + May participate in staff meetings, patient care meetings, educational in-services, caregiver orientation and other professional activities. + Performs other duties as assigned. What you bring: + Bachelor's, Master's or Doctorate Degree Required: Physical Therapy accredited by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education or closely related field (foreign equivalent accepted) + Required : Physical Therapist License State of Oregon + Required Upon Hire: Basic Life Support PeaceHealth is committed to the overall wellbeing of our caregivers: physical, emotional, financial, social, and spiritual.
